Ghost Immobiliser Reviews

Autowatch Ghost is an established car security system that protects against key-cloning, and other kinds of theft. It also helps you save money on insurance by preventing thieves from tampering or taking your vehicle.

It operates by intercepting the communication between the car key fob and the ECU. A PIN code is required to turn off the engine. It's completely invisible, leaving no visible marks on the vehicle's interior, and operates discreetly.

Effectiveness

The Ghost Immobiliser is a state-of-the-art anti-theft device that can help stop vehicle theft. It offers protection from common carjacking tactics such as relay attacks and key cloning. It is not detectable by thieves using diagnostics and does not block radio signals.



Ghost immobilisers are security device that connects to your car's CAN data network and prevents the vehicle from starting until a pre-set PIN code sequence is entered. The system is completely silent and does not require any additional hardware or additional buttons. It works with the buttons you already have, and doesn't alter your interior look. It is harder for thieves to spot than traditional immobilisers since it doesn't require an entirely new keypad.

The PIN code could be as long as 20 characters and may include any combination on the steering wheel, doors, or the center console. The PIN code is typically created by the owner, and should be kept secret to ensure maximum security. It is important to remember that no security system is 100% secure. Criminals are always looking for ways to evade even the most advanced systems. As a result, it is vital to encase your vehicle's security with other technologies and to update them regularly.

Installation

Installation of a Ghost immobiliser requires a professional's training and experience. An experienced installer will integrate the device into your vehicle's CAN data network and ensure that it is in communication with your vehicle's ECU. It is a complicated procedure that could require the removal of interior panels as well as the disconnecting of cables. This isn't a task for the faint-hearted, since each step has to be taken carefully and precisely to avoid damage.

Ghost immobilisers block vehicles from starting until the driver enters an already-set PIN code. This security feature is efficient against modern keyless vehicles and has proven highly effective in the fight against hotwiring, a common kind of car theft that was prevalent in the 90s. The thieves are becoming technologically adept and have evolved into a more sophisticated form of theft, known as relay car theft. The Ghost immobiliser is undetectable to these thieves and prevents them from using their RF scanners or devices that grab codes.

Disconnecting the battery is the first step towards installing a Ghost immobiliser. This will prevent short circuits as well as accidental airbag deployment during the installation process. Then, find the CAN High and CAN Low wires on the wiring diagram for your vehicle. Connect your Ghost immobiliser using these wires. Use cable ties to tidy up the wiring to avoid accidental disconnections and damage. Double-check that all connections are secure and well-insulated.
